Shrestha toils as Tamang storms into semis

KATHMANDU, Sept 8: Nepal champion Pooja Shrestha and former Nepal champion Sara Devi Tamang fixed their semifinal spots as group winners in the women´s singles of the ongoing First Pushpa Lal Memorial Ranking Badminton Tournament on Thursday.



Shrestha and Tamang qualified for the semifinal undefeated in the group stage matches from group A and B respectively.[break]



Shrestha had won three matches on the first day of the tournament but she had to toil hard on the second day to beat fifth seeded Sabina Pantjhi 22-20, 21-19. Another semifinalist, Tamang won her remaining two matches of the group stage as she defeated seventh seeded Poonam Gurung 21-9, 21-10 and fourth seeded Mina Shrestha 21-9, 21-5.



Second seeded Nangsal Devi Tamang and Sabina Panhti also qualified for the semifinals as the runners-up from their respective groups. Tamang easily beat sixth seeded Samjhana Sharma 21-10, 21-10 in her last match of group B.



Panthi overcame Jalmaya Gurung 21-12, 21-11 in group A to fix her place in the semifinals.



Top seeded Shrestha will meet second seeded Nangsal Devi in the semifinal while Sara Devi will lock horns with Sabina Panthi.



In the men´s section, 14th seeded Dipesh Dhami topped group A and qualified for the quarterfinals. From the same group, Nepal champion Bikash Shrestha also qualified for the quarterfinals as runner-up. From group B, 19th ranked Ram Singh Chaudhary qualified for the knockout round as group winner and Indra Mahata as runner-up.



Sajan Krishna Tamrakar and Sahadev Khadka qualified for the quarterfinals from group C while Ratnajit Tamang and Pankaj Chand made it from group D after securing the top two spots respectively.



Dhami defeated Sanjeev Khadka 21-14, 22-20 in the first match of the second day and Sudip Sedai 21-10, 21-13. In the last group stage match, Nepal No 1 Shrestha humiliated Sanjeev Khadka 21-5, 21-7.



Second seeded Tamang continued his dominance on the second day as he over powered Pankaj Chand 21-17, 21-10 and received a walkover from Surya Shrestha, who met with an accident in Dharan prior to the tournament. Chand qualified for the quarterfinals with three wins from four matches. Chand also received a walkover from Shrestha.



Ram Singh Chaudhary won his both matches. He defeated Basanta Bajracharya 21-11, 21-14 and Bishal Pradhan 21-17, 17-21, 21-14. Third seeded Indra Mahata registered 21-13, 21-17 win over Rajan Shivakoti in his last match of the group stage.



Fourth seeded Sajan Krishna Tamrakar continued his dominance in the tournament as he beat Surya Thapa 21-14, 21-11 and Bilal Barsi 21-19, 21-16. Sahadev Khadka registered three wins from four matches and qualified for the quarterfinals.
